Output 6b905cecd6cf98338668a8f5bf13d138a05c24988ae0b6950c336426b38b0f26:26

value
114677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96c3364e7c1d4396102f9856845aa5f5a3235a21 OP_EQUAL
address
3FSB8tssFV6TxXooWNBBZUiHAQxYwQpLmN
transaction
6b905cecd6cf98338668a8f5bf13d138a05c24988ae0b6950c336426b38b0f26
confirmations
255001
spent
true